How would you describe what you did at United Parcel Service?

I unload packages off of tractor trailor beds. I also scan packages to be placed in the correct package car. Often I assist in loading package cars so that our drivers will have packages easily accessible for delivery. I have participated in our "helper" system which I was required to learn the ins and outs of our drivers responsibilities and duties.... read more

How would you describe what you did at United Parcel Service?

Managed the Labor Relations Office for UPS. Skills acquired were but not limited to: customer service, employee and public relations with District Level Management, as well as District and National Union Representatives, office supply purchasing, disciplinary procedures, report generation, contract re-writing, process grievances, file archiving, event planning, travel arrangements , develop/initiate/schedule and present labor relations seminars and contract administration and ratification in a very fast-paced environment. Other duties included inventory control, training in safety measures, and analyzing/projecting budgetary needs for the District office, as well as the Obetz facility. I completely automated the Labor Relations Office. Also responsible for recruiting, managing and administering of benefits for clerical employees. Responsible for reviewing resumes and qualifying candidates, scheduling/tracking interviews, subsequent interviews and intensive reference checks, providing offers of employment, training the new associate for their position and providing benefit support for the new associates. How would you describe what you did at United Parcel Service?

During the christmas hoildays of 2005 and 2006, I was responsible for meeting the drivers at the locations, and assist the drivers in delivering and/or picking up packages from customers. Often times I used the DIAD boards to scan in packages for each stop required.
